lss
2025-06-05 71129e21a35a2d4be75ee0f1e96e2c51ced5f23b
HH.WCS.Mobox3/HH.WCS.Mobox3.DaYang/wms/WCSHelper.cs
@@ -145,7 +145,7 @@
            }
            return res;
        }
        internal static bool AddActionRecord(string no, int state, string forkliftNo, string extData,string Type)
        internal static bool AddActionRecord(string no, int state, string forkliftNo, string extData, string Type)
        {
            var db = new SqlHelper<TaskAction>().GetInstance();
            var action = new TaskAction()
@@ -236,7 +236,7 @@
        internal static List<WCSTask> GetTaskbyType(string type)
        {
            var db = new SqlHelper<object>().GetInstance();
            string[] statue = new string[] { "完成", "取消", "错误","等待" };
            string[] statue = new string[] { "完成", "取消", "错误", "等待" };
            return db.Queryable<WCSTask>().Where(a => a.S_TYPE == type && !statue.Contains(a.S_B_STATE)).ToList();
        }
@@ -245,6 +245,12 @@
            var db = new SqlHelper<object>().GetInstance();
            return db.Queryable<WCSTask>().Where(a => a.N_B_STATE == state).ToList();
        }
        internal static WCSTask GetTaskByOpName(string opCode, int state)
        {
            var db = new SqlHelper<object>().GetInstance();
            return db.Queryable<WCSTask>().Where(a => a.S_OP_CODE == opCode && a.N_B_STATE == state).First();
        }
        internal static List<WCSTask> GetWaitingTaskList()
        {
            var db = new SqlHelper<object>().GetInstance();